A History of the It Girl

The it girl – what’s an it girl?  Gossip about it girls has sold newspapers for many years and there was recently even a novel released called The It Girl.  There have been it girls on both sides of the Atlantic.  British ones and continental European ones.  But, what is an it girl and how did it all get started?

An it girl is an attractive young woman on the cutting edge of fashion and the social set.  They are the sort of girls that gossip columns love to write about and they provide the newspapers with plenty of material.  It’s difficult to imagine how they manage to hold down any sort of job given how often they are out partying.  Having enough money to finance their lifestyle is important. Despite a punishing social schedule, they keep up to date with fashion trends.  They are always to be found where the ‘in crowd is’.  They are at the right parties, eat in the right restaurants and holiday in the right vacation destinations.

The expression it girl was first heard in British upper-class society around the turn of the 20th century in those glamourous Edwardian days. It gained further attention in 1927 with the popularity of the Paramount Studios film It, starring Clara Bow. The Oxford English Dictionary distinguishes between the chiefly American usage of “a glamorous, vivacious, or sexually attractive actress, model, etc.”, and the chiefly British usage of “a young, rich woman who has achieved celebrity because of her socialite lifestyle”.

Evelyn Nesbit was one of the first of the it girls.  She started as an artist’s model and married a millionaire. Along came the swinging sixties with Jane Asher, Jean Shrimpton and Twiggy.  The 1990s were peak time for it girls.  It girls like Tara Palmer-Tomkinson and Tamara Beckwith were rich and beautiful. They were often aristocratic or at least posh and many didn’t have serious job.  It would be difficult to fit in all that partying and manage a career as well.

The US has seen its share of it girls too.  High society girls like Gloria Vanderbilt and Lee Radziwill (Jackie O’s younger sister) led the way.  More recently models, music artistes and actresses like  Marisa Berenson, Grace Jones and Iman have all had their moment in the spotlight.  And bang up to date we have the Kardashian-Jenners: a whole dynasty of it girls. 

Social media has seen the it girl roadshow become self sustaining.  It’s now no longer just about newspaper column inches and paparazzi.  These days image is all important with Instagram in particular creating many new it girls.  In some ways it makes becoming an it girl more accessible, but on the other hand you have to work a lot harder at it.  Some Instagram it girls will have a whole team supporting them and their social media rise.  What does that mean for the future of the it girl?  Will there still be such a thing?  Will it girls be shorter lived phenomenons in the social media age or will it be easier to maintain and support a personal brand because it girls will have more control over how they are portrayed?
